
Ciro Guerra
Ciro Guerra is a Colombian filmmaker known for his unique storytelling and visual style. He gained international acclaim for his films such as 'El abrazo de la serpiente' (2015), which explores the Amazonian experience through the eyes of indigenous tribes and Western explorers. His works often delve into themes of culture, identity, and humanity's relationship with nature, making significant contributions to Colombian cinema and earning numerous awards at film festivals around the globe.
